SSM+Vue+MySQL美容院管理系统源码及文档下载
版权申诉
5星 · 超过95%的资源 125 浏览量
更新于2024-11-15
收藏 17.02MB ZIP 举报
一、项目概述
该资源包包含了一套完整的基于SSM框架的美容院管理系统,系统采用了Vue作为前端框架,后端基于Spring、SpringMVC和MyBatis(SMM)进行开发,数据库使用MySQL,同时提供完整的开发文档和数据库脚本。该系统适合于计算机专业的毕业生进行毕业设计,也适合Java学习者进行项目实战练习,同时也可以作为课程设计和期末大作业的参考资料。
二、技术要点
1. 开发语言:Java
Java是一种广泛使用的面向对象编程语言,具有跨平台、面向对象、多线程等多种特性,是实现该系统的开发语言。
2. 框架:SSM
- Spring:提供了全面的编程和配置模型,管理企业级应用程序的配置和生命周期。
- SpringMVC:作为Spring的一个模块,它是一个基于Java的实现了MVC设计模式的请求驱动类型的轻量级Web框架。
- MyBatis:是一个支持定制化SQL、存储过程以及高级映射的持久层框架。
3. JDK版本:JDK1.8
系统使用Java Development Kit版本1.8进行开发,这是Java的一个稳定版本,提供了新的特性,如Lambda表达式等。
4. 服务器:Tomcat7+
系统部署在Apache Tomcat服务器上,版本需要至少7.0以上。
5. 数据库:MySQL 5.7+
MySQL作为关系型数据库管理系统被使用,版本为5.7或更高版本,用于存储系统数据。
6. 数据库工具:Navicat11+
Navicat11+被用作数据库管理工具,便于数据库的日常管理和脚本的编写。
7. 开发软件:IDEA/Eclipse
系统开发过程中使用了IntelliJ IDEA或Eclipse作为集成开发环境,这两者是Java开发者广泛使用的IDE工具。
8. Maven包:Maven3.3
项目使用了Maven3.3版本进行项目管理和构建,Maven是一个项目管理工具,提供了一套标准的项目构建和依赖管理机制。
三、系统功能
本美容院管理系统可能包括但不限于以下功能:
- 用户管理:对顾客信息和员工信息进行管理,包括增加、删除、修改和查询。
- 预约管理:顾客可以通过系统进行预约服务,员工可对预约进行管理。
- 服务项目管理:管理美容院提供的服务项目,包括新增项目、修改项目信息等。
- 收银管理:记录顾客消费情况,处理支付结算。
- 库存管理:对美容院的物资库存进行管理,如化妆品、工具等。
- 报表统计:根据需要生成各种经营报表和统计信息。
四、使用说明
该资源包提供了完整的系统源码、数据库脚本和开发说明文档,用户在使用前应确保开发环境已安装好JDK、Tomcat服务器、MySQL数据库以及对应的开发工具。安装步骤一般包括导入数据库脚本、配置项目源码中数据库连接信息、编译并部署至Tomcat服务器等。开发说明文档中会详细描述系统的安装、配置以及运行步骤,用户需要仔细阅读并按照指示操作。
五、项目特色
- 源码质量高:系统经过严格测试,保证运行无误,适合用于毕业设计等学术用途。
- 实战性强:通过该项目的开发,学生和技术学习者可以加深对Java、SSM框架以及Vue前端框架的理解和运用能力。
- 完整性好:提供从后端到前端完整的代码,以及与之配套的数据库脚本和开发文档,可以作为一个完整项目的范例。
六、注意事项
在使用本系统时,用户应确保遵守相关版权规定,尊重开发者劳动成果,未经许可不得用于商业用途。同时,针对个人学习和毕业设计等非商业性用途,用户应根据指导老师的建议和反馈,适当修改和调整系统功能,以满足实际需求。
通过以上详细的介绍,我们了解到这套基于SSM+Vue+MySQL的美容院管理系统不仅为用户提供了一个高效、实用的软件产品,也对提升Java开发者的项目实战技能有着重要的帮助。
2024-01-04 上传
2023-04-28 上传
2023-07-13 上传
2023-05-09 上传
2023-07-12 上传
2023-08-30 上传
2024-04-18 上传
2023-04-25 上传
点击了解资源详情
出世&入世
- 粉丝: 537
最新资源
- Sybase15系统管理指南:AdaptiveServerEnterprise中文手册
- Sybase15 AdaptiveServerEnterprise 中文系统表手册
- Eclipse IDE详解:从基础到高级设置
- 深入学习Java:Bruce Eckel的第四版思维之书
- Eclipse整合开发工具基础教程详解
- NIOS II 开发教程:从用户指令到DMA与UART实战
- 操作系统的LRU页面置换算法实现
- STL实战指南:提升编程效率与应对挑战
- TMS320C54XX DSP硬件结构与设计解析
- 自编数据结构文本编辑器实现与错误修正
- VC++6.0实现密码学大数加减乘除源代码示例
- Java贪吃蛇游戏实现:SnakeGame.java代码解析
- 适应性外包发展:寻找最合适的技术与策略
- Libsvm与Matlab集成:教程与路径设置详解
- Oracle 10g 数据库基础概念详解
- S3C6410 RISC Microprocessor User's Manual